Назад | Перейти на главную страницу

Помогите с установкой веб-сервера Apache!

Ладно, до недавнего времени меня принимал кто-то другой. Теперь я пробую веб-сервер Apache (который повторяет очевидное, учитывая заголовок).

Я скачал вот это: httpd-2.2.19-win32-x86-openssl-0.9.8r.msi Это правильная версия? Я использую Windows 7 Home Premium.

Когда я его установил ..
сетевой домен: the-social-project.info
название сервера: the-social-project.info
адрес электронной почты администратора: myemailadress@yaddayadda.com
Я не уверен, следует ли мне делать первые два разными или нет. Я следил за учебником, и они сделали то же самое для обоих.

Затем в руководстве мне было сказано перейти на http: // localhost. Плохие новости, я закончил "Работает!"

Как это исправить? Пожалуйста, объясните мне это очень и очень просто. Я никогда не принимал себя раньше.

Спасибо за уделенное время!
-Эми

PS: О да. Кроме того, я проверил, открыт ли мой порт 80 - да, это так. Это должно быть?

Эми, это ожидаемое поведение для собственной установки apache. Чтобы ответить на ваши вопросы напрямую

Я не уверен, стоит ли делать первые два разными или нет. Я следил за учебником, и они сделали то же самое для обоих.

На самом деле это не имеет значения, имя сервера должно быть URL-адресом, по которому вы хотите получить доступ к своему сайту, если вы собираетесь разместить на нем только один сайт (виртуальные хосты выходят за рамки этого)

Затем в руководстве мне было сказано перейти на http: // localhost. Плохие новости, я закончил "Работает!" Как это исправить? Пожалуйста, объясните мне это очень, очень просто. Я никогда не принимал себя раньше.

Это правильное поведение, это стандартная страница Apache после установки. Скорее всего, его можно найти в c: \ Program Files \ Apache Software Foundation \ Apache2.2 \ htdocs, здесь вы должны поместить свои файлы HTML. По умолчанию Apache будет работать только с HTML, вы не сможете использовать какие-либо динамические страницы, такие как PHP или ColdFusion, для этого также требуется запуск сервера приложений или обработчика страниц, но опять же, это выходит за рамки этого вопроса.

Однако я бы сделал здесь несколько предупреждений. Если вы используете потребительское интернет-соединение, ваш интернет-провайдер может заблокировать порт 80, поскольку он обычно не хочет, чтобы люди, размещающие веб-сайты и т. Д., Использовали свои услуги, они хотят, чтобы вы платили за бизнес-соединение. Кроме того, ваш компьютер должен быть постоянно включен, когда ваш компьютер выключен, ваш веб-сайт выключен. Вам нужно самостоятельно управлять резервными копиями, исправлениями, обновлениями и безопасностью.

Если вам комфортно со всем этим, тогда приступайте к этому, но если вы этого не делаете или только тестируете и тренируетесь, я бы рекомендовал получить хостинговую компанию, которая будет управлять этим за вас.

Затем в руководстве мне было сказано перейти на http: // localhost. Плохие новости, я закончил "Работает!"

Это хорошие новости.

Теперь вам просто нужно указать серверу каталог, в котором находится ваш веб-контент, либо изменив DocumentRoot установка в вашем httpd.conf файл (который должен находиться в папке, в которую установлен Apache, возможно, где-то в Program Files), или перемещение вашего веб-контента в существующий DocumentRoot расположение.